i noticed in your sig that you list your tranny as an e4od. i thought that the 302's came w/ aod's (later on aode's, aka 4r70w) and 351's had the e4od. please tell me if i am wrong. thanks.

the E40d was introduced in 1989, but made it into the F-150's in 1990. I think most 1992-on 302's have the E40d. My 1989 F-150 has the AOD. I believe the last year for the non-electronic AOD was in 1993. Then it became the 4r70w. Most of the 302' equipped F-150's of the 92-96 era had the e40d's around here. My truck's were both manu'd from the Norfolk assy. plant. It could be that other plants didn't use the e40d or something.
